Heartbreak in the capital as Caps fall to Flyers

The UC Capitals Finals dreams ended on Tuesday night after suffering an 82-75 defeat to the Southside Melbourne Flyers in a hard-fought contest that saw both sides playing desperate basketball.

With the way the ladder unfolded throughout the season, it became apparent even through late December and early January that this game was probably going to decide who gets the last Finals ticket and both teams put on a performance worthy of a do-or-die contest.

First quarter

The Caps got off to a hot start led by Nicole Munger who came out of the gates firing with 11 first quarter points. Jade Melbourne also started aggressively draining a three of her own and drawing two shooting fouls in the quarter. While the Flyers settled a bit, the Caps ended the first quarter up 26-20.

Second quarter

Jadeo opened the quarter with her 2nd three-ball of the contest to stretch the lead to 9, but from there, the Flyers steadily chipped away eventually tying the game at 35 on a Cayla George three, and subsequently taking the lead courtesy of Tera Reed at the line. From there, the teams would trade baskets and battle to a standstill at halftime 44-all.

Munger and Jade led the Caps with 11 and 10 points respectively.

Third quarter

The third quarter featured more of the same from both sides – one team would make a basket, the other would follow suit. The Flyers eventually opened up a bit of a gap through Issy Bourne, Maddy Rocci, and Haley Peters, but Jade and Munger’s 3pt shooting kept the Caps within striking distance entering the final frame down only by 4, 64-60.

Fourth quarter

The Caps started this one with Emme Shearer hitting a 3 and Nards converting a fastbreak layup off a steal to take back the lead 65-64. They had chances to extend the lead, holding the Flyers scoreless through the first 2:30 of the quarter but couldn’t capitalise. From there, the Flyers took advantage – scoring 9 straight points as the Caps offensive struggles surfaced at the worst possible time. Jade Melbourne’s layup with 4 minutes remaining would end a 5-minute scoring drought but the Flyers would quickly answer back. Down 75-69 with 2:30 left in the game, the Caps had a chance to get close after Nards emphatically blocked Rocci’s layup but Isa’s 3-pt attempt went missing and Z missed her shot off an offensive board. On the other end, Haylee Andrew drilled a dagger triple to essentially dash the Caps hopes.

FINAL SCORE

UC Capitals 75
Southside Melboure Flyers 82

KEY PERFORMERS

Caps

Jade Melbourne – 23 pts (8/15 fg), 6 rebs, 3 asts
Nicole Munger – 17 pts (6/12 fg), 4 rebs, 2 asts, 2 stls
Nyadiew Puoch – 10 pts (3/8 fg), 4 rebs, 3 asts, 3 stls, 4 blks

Flyers

Isabelle Bourne – 22 pts (9/10 fg) 3 rebs, 4 asts
Maddy Rocci – 17 pts (6/17 fg), 2 rebs, 10 asts, 4 stls
Cayla George – 10 pts (4/8 fg), 15 rebs, 4 asts, 2 stls, 4 blks
